ZIP code 03782 in Sunapee, New Hampshire has a population of 2,945. The median household income is $110,175, which is 44% above the national average. Median home value is $412,000, 48% above the US average. 49.4%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
ZIP code 03782 is classified by USPS as a standard delivery area and covers roughly 54.5 square miles in Sunapee, Sullivan County, New Hampshire. The area is home to 2,945 residents, producing a population density of 54 people per square mile, and falls within the New York time zone. These USPS and Census boundary values drive every downstream statistic on this page, including the benchmarks that compare 03782 against New Hampshire and the nation.
On the economic side, the median household income for ZIP 03782 sits at $110,175 (8% above the New Hampshire average), while per-capita income is $62,363. The poverty rate stands at 13.3% and the unemployment rate at 0.0%. On housing, the median home value is $412,000 (2% above the state average) with median rent at $1,713 per month, and 72.6% of occupied units are owner-occupied, a direct signal of whether 03782 behaves more like a homeowner neighborhood or a renter-heavy ZIP.
Education and household profile round out the picture: 49.4%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 56.2, and the average commute is 33 minutes. How have home values changed over time?
FHFA House Price Index, annual appreciation data based on repeat sales and appraisals
+19.7%
YoY Change (2024)
405
HPI Index (2000 = 100)
+305%
Total Change Since 2000
Home values in ZIP 03782 have increased 19.7% over the past year (2024). Since 2000, this ZIP has seen +305% cumulative appreciation.
| Year | Annual Change | HPI Index |
|---|---|---|
| 2020 | +2.6% | 220 |
| 2021 | +15.7% | 254 |
| 2022 | +23.6% | 314 |
| 2023 | +7.8% | 339 |
| 2024 | +19.7% | 405 |
Source: Federal Housing Finance Agency (FHFA) House Price Index, All-Transactions, Five-Digit ZIP Codes (Developmental Index). Index base = 100 in year 2000. Data through 2024. ZIP codes with few transactions may show missing values.
What businesses operate in this ZIP?
Census Bureau data shows 84 business establishments in ZIP 03782, employing approximately 330 people with a combined annual payroll of $22,860,000.
84
Businesses
330
Employees
$22.9M
Annual Payroll
11
Industry Sectors
| Industry | Establishments | % of Total |
|---|---|---|
| Construction | 18 | 21.4% |
| Retail trade | 8 | 9.5% |
| Professional, scientific, and technical services | 8 | 9.5% |
| Real estate and rental and leasing | 7 | 8.3% |
| Administrative and support and waste management and remediation services | 7 | 8.3% |
| Accommodation and food services | 7 | 8.3% |
| Manufacturing | 6 | 7.1% |
| Finance and insurance | 6 | 7.1% |
| Other services (except public administration) | 5 | 6.0% |
| Wholesale trade | 3 | 3.6% |
| Health care and social assistance | 3 | 3.6% |
Source: U.S. Census Bureau, ZIP Code Business Patterns (ZBP), 2023. Employment figures may include noise for disclosure avoidance.
